And now a little about the features of creating presentations. Let's start with the main components of any presentation and their purpose.

Illustrations and color

Illustrations are used to quickly convey the meaning of the slide, since pictures are perceived much faster than text. The chosen color also plays an important role here, it will allow you to correctly place accents and highlight the text against the general background and pictures.

You can use any image - from funny pictures to attract attention and increase the interest of viewers to infographics, without which it is difficult to imagine, for example, presentations of economic or analytical companies.

Lists

We often see lists on presentation slides. The thing is that structuring information allows you to improve its perception. In addition, the amount of information itself is significantly reduced, since all the most important things are expressed in theses in the list items.

Lists can also be designed in the most unexpected way, up to the design in the form of comics.

Titles

Headings are an indispensable part of each presentation slide and carry a great semantic load, as they reveal the whole meaning of each slide.

conclusions

Often in presentations large volumes of rather heavy information are presented. Help the audience understand it better and draw conclusions at the end of each slide or series of slides, sum up, highlighting the most important points. Such an information box is usually located at the bottom of the slide and is designed as a note or footnote.

What to include in a presentation

1. Tell a story

Listening to history is much more interesting than a dry enumeration of facts, excerpts from books and statistics. Turn your presentation into a captivating, imaginative story. So the necessary information will be remembered by listeners.

2. Consider the structure

You need to understand what your presentation will be about and how exactly you will convey information to the audience before you start collecting a document in one of the services. No matter how attractive the design is, if the structure is lame and the facts are presented chaotically, it is unlikely to work.

3. Prioritize images

Today, not everyone likes to read. If text can be replaced with images, do so. Use the icons beautiful pictures, qualitative schemes and diagrams. Looking at them is more interesting than reading a large array of text.

4. Remove everything unnecessary

If you can refuse something without compromising the meaning, feel free to do it. Cutting off everything unnecessary, shortening the text, removing distracting effects, you formulate your thoughts more accurately. The clearer your message, the easier it is for the audience to perceive it.

2. Use 3-5 colors

This is a rule that allows you to avoid too colorful design that distracts from the content of the presentation.

There are three base colors and two additional (shades of the primary colors, they are used if necessary). The first color is allocated for the background, the second and third for the text. The colors that are used for text should be contrasting so that the content is easy to read.

As a rule, among the main colors there are corporate colors of your company. If there are none, you can use one of the sites for the selection of flowers.

1. Rehearse

Rehearsal - good way cope with the excitement and once again systematize the information for yourself. Speak in front of a mirror or colleagues - this will help you stay more confident. If possible, use Presenter View (like Keynote has one). In this mode, slide notes, timing, next slide, and other useful information will be displayed on your computer screen during your presentation.

2. Talk to the audience

A successful presentation is a dialogue, not a monologue. Ask the audience what they think about this or that matter, whether they agree with you, or if they have a different opinion. Interactive will make the presentation not only more memorable, but also more productive - both for the speaker and for the audience.

3. Be aware of the timing

As a rule, the time required for a presentation is calculated from the ratio 1 minute = 1 slide. So, if you have 20 slides, the presentation will take at least 20 minutes. Keep an eye on the time, because too fast presentation of the material will not be effective, and a prolonged presentation will not please the audience.

2 Use 3-5 base colors when creating presentations.

Please do not use more than 5 different colors in your presentation. Moreover, use only 3 base colors, as the other 2 are usually shades of the base colors. How to choose a color palette.

⁃ One of the three shades should be highlighted for the background. Decide right away - it will be a presentation with a light or dark background. If you are an advanced designer, you can try to alternate, but in this article I skip these experiments.

⁃ Next, choose a color for the text. It should be as contrasting as possible with respect to the background color. The ideal and often found option: the background is white - the text is black. But this option is inferior in terms of creativity :) So let's look at a few examples. Maybe I can give you some ideas:Gray background, blue body text and dark gray accent. White background, black text, blue accent. 3 Colors. Alternates with a dark background and white text. dark background, white text, lime accent. Shades of light green are also used here and a dark and light background alternates.

3 Refuse 3D icons from search engines - turn to linear and flat icons.

Unfortunately, I still often see slides that use voluminous low-quality icons. Now it is an outdated theme and looks very ugly. And some do not use icons at all, which is also bad, because visualization is important in the presentation, and not just solid text. Purpose of icons: replace unnecessary text and speed up the memorability and comprehensibility of information. My advice to you: use icons from this resource when creating a presentation - flaticon.com

Flaticon icons will make your presentation more modern and concise.

There is a section there Packs", where you can find icons of the same style on a specific topic from one designer. I advise you to select icons in a complex way so that everyone is in the same style.

Subconsciously, we feel every detail in the presentation up to the line thickness of the icons, and if this thickness is different between the icons, then the presentation immediately ceases to harmonize, and subconsciously we no longer perceive it as a quality one.

Also, when working with icons, I want to note such a trend among people as "syndrome of blindness". This is when everything in the presentation is done in large sizes - "for everyone to see." Making everything huge will greatly reduce the quality of your presentation, and icons only look good at small sizes. Let's look at an example:

4 Each slide is a picture and needs a frame. Or not needed?

When creating a presentation, respect the frame from the borders of the slide. Moreover, large frames are in fashion now. Important: the distance from the borders to the content of the slide should be the same on all sides. Example:
What can happen? It may turn out that the content that you planned to place does not fit on one slide, and that's good! No need to try to cram everything on one page. It's better to split it into two slides with the same title.

One slide - one message.

Why do everything in large sizes - the slide needs air.

Here are five quick tips to help you get the most out of your infographic PPT theme:

1. Simplify slide design

Representing data as much as possible in an effective way will raise your authority. It will positively influence the opinion of the audience, help promote your brand and close deals.

Check the data and be careful with them. Your information must be presented in a clean manner.

Unify your design. Keep in mind that one color combines similar information, while different ones are designed to separate it. Using modern sans serif fonts will add consistency to the presentation of the data. Do not overcrowd slides, leave more free space.

2. Be Clarity and Focus

You probably have a pile of data to review. It can be difficult to select the information you need to view, but this is the key to impact. Determine your emphasis for each slide. Even better would be to focus on a single value for each element.

This is the principle of building any frame. Keep in mind that the more comparable data you offer, the more you confuse your audience. When in doubt, add another slide to divert attention to it. Bring clarity of thought to each slide.

3. Make your data the protagonist

Your goal is to provide deep knowledge. Your information should be exclusive and understandable for listeners.

A little confusion in the data can easily be confusing. Do you really need this description section? Is this photo of men in suits real? Are all those pointing arrows in the right place? Questions you should ask for each element. Each component should add appeal to the data and not confuse the audience with your thoughts.

4. Select the best infographics

There are countless ways to present your data: graphs, flowcharts, charts, comparison tables, line graphs, histograms - ad infinitum.

Choose the graphic options that best suit your information. The format used for visualization should clarify your point of view, make it the most understandable.

5. Tell a story in pictures

It's tempting to show all your research data, but it will overwhelm viewers. Take only those that are necessary for the story. Guide the audience through showing the plot of the story.

If you're doing a sales presentation, show something that will make the audience rush to buy. If you are promoting the idea of ​​starting a business, offer information that will get these venture capitalists to invest in it. If you inspire your team with quarterly accomplishments, show numbers that reflect the milestones you've achieved.

Have a clear goal and choose data to achieve it.
